Noahark2 Posted November 12, 2005 Report Share Posted November 12, 2005 I recorded a bunch of live music on my himd and transferred a lot of it to my laptop. I can convert it to wave and the move it to my other computer but this takes up a lot of space. I used ss 3.2 on both computers. . My impression was that you could move the oma files and have them play as they had no drm under sonic stage 3.2 . I can't play them on my other computer. I can upload them again however and do it. I could also use the backup tool.Can the oma files from my recordings be directly transferred (easily) and still work?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
atrain Posted November 12, 2005 Report Share Posted November 12, 2005 you need to make sure they don't have DRM on the file. choose the track/s in sonicstage & reconvert them to the bitrate & format they are allready in. make sure the tick box for drm reflects what you'd like.after this process you can search [windows desktop -> F3 -> *.oma] then move the files you want manually. otherwise please update to SS3.3 - it seems to have no drm unless specified. Syrius Posted November 12, 2005 Report Share Posted November 12, 2005 Now keep in mind that Oma files that have been uploaded from MD will have DRM. Only files you have imported from CDs or your own media files, AND converted to OMA, will be DRM-less after you uncheck the copy protection option when importing.
